What you can expect as an Interior Technician at West Star:
As an Interior technician you will be working on some of the most sophisticated private aircraft in the world. Duties can include removal and installation of carpeting, insulation, sound proofing and fabric accessories; varying amounts of parts replacement/repair, basic electrical system installation, modifications, refurbishments and general mechanical applications on aircraft interiors. Job duties will vary by type and scope, as designated by the Interior Team Leader.
Our weekend Shift schedule is Friday-Sunday, 6am-6:30pm. The shift incentive includes a 11.11% shift differential and 3 day workweek.

Company Description:
With over 78 years of industry experience, West Star Aviation stands as a leading independent Maintenance, Repair and Overhaul (MRO) provider. Employing over 3,000 professionals, we offer comprehensive services from our strategically located full-service facilities in East Alton, IL; Grand Junction, CO; Chattanooga, TN; Millville, NJ; Perryville, Missouri; and Statesville, NC as well as satellite locations in Denver, Houston, Minneapolis and Chicago. Our extensive capabilities encompass maintenance, paint, interior, and avionics services, supported by the largest Aircraft On Ground (AOG) network in the country, ensuring prompt and reliable mobile repair services nationwide.
